This article discusses accidents which have involved police vehicles. Some accidents have led to injuries or fatalities. A two year research project analysed data relating to police accidents. The number of fatalities each year in police accidents varied from 38 to 52. A total of 275 incidents were investigated. These incidents related to: pursuit; emergency responseor other types of traffic activity. As a result of this research project recommendations have been made for changes in police policy in relation toaccidents involving police vehicles.
